‘Just look at my own team’

It has also not gone unnoticed by Red Bull team boss Christian Horner that Mercedes, the great rival of recent years, is struggling with its W13 car under the new regulations this year. However, there is no question of pity or amusement.

In fact, it does nothing for Horner, he is quoted by the British newspaper Express† “They struggle”, Horner also concludes, but: “That doesn’t bother me, I have no feelings about it. I’m just focusing on being competitive in what is currently a very intense battle with Ferrari.”

That said, Horner believes Mercedes will eventually recover from its struggles. “I have no doubt that they will join the fray at some point, but so focus on my own team,” he repeats.

Where the title battle between Red Bull and Mercedes in 2021 was very tough and also had a very sharp edge off the track, it is (for now) more respectful with Ferrari. “Fighting Ferrari is always different,” says Horner Eurosportalthough there may still be something to it: “There may also be a little less animosity than has developed between us and some of our other rivals.”
